IEEE Access (Jan 2024)

Blockchain-Enabled Secure Communication Framework for Enhancing Trust and Access Control in the Internet of Vehicles (IoV)

  • Sadia Hussain,
  • Shahzaib Tahir,
  • Asif Masood,
  • Hasan Tahir

DOI
https://doi.org/10.1109/ACCESS.2024.3431279
Journal volume & issue
Vol. 12
pp. 110992 – 111006

Abstract

Read online

The Internet of Vehicles (IoV) is an incipient topic within the wider domain of the Internet of Things (IoT). Using this technology intelligent transportation systems (ITS) can be developed, whose main purpose is to ensure more safety, faster travel, reduced energy consumption and improved vehicle upkeep. Devices connected within the IoV transmit a vast amount of data, which leads to additional costs on the communication network along with data security concerns. This research considers the potential uses of blockchain technology for improving communication between independent vehicles. In this paper, a decentralized system is proposed to enhance the security and performance of financial transactions in the network of autonomous cars based on the Ethereum blockchain. Our system is divided into two modules: car registration and message alert generating. New vehicles are allowed on the network using the smart contract that has been written and published on the Ethereum Remix IDE. This is the contract code attached to the Metamask wallet. Another module, the message alert-generating module, allows an administrator to send alert messages to all registered cars via a web-based system to their wallet for an Ethereum gas cost. It ensures the reliability of data transferred between the self-driving cars through the use of blockchain-based systems. The data is, therefore, confirmed and vetted using the proof of work and stake consensus algorithm to bring out the truth. The transaction being made, the system will see to it that the transaction made is of integrity and trustable. By synching all these technologies and means of reaching an agreement, the blockchain secures not only the means of keeping and retaining the information of the kept within self-driving vehicles but also establishes a strong foundation of highest trust and transparency in the interaction between the vehicles on the network. Accordingly, a well-defined and reliable conceptual design for the communication systems of autonomous vehicles has been proposed. Future work and the unresolved issues of using blockchain for autonomous vehicles have also been deliberated over in detail.

Keywords